Soulmates.AI Targets Social Media Measurement

socalTECH

Pasadena-based startup Soulmates.AI said today that it has launched a new tool, Social ROI Reporter, which it says helps brands and agencies with measuring the dollar value of their social media and influencer marketing campaigns.

X1 Discovery Ships Social Media Discovery Software

socalTECH

Pasadena-based X1 Discovery , the Idealab-backed electronic discovery firm split out from X1, said today that it has shipped its first product, X1 Social Discovery. The firm spun out X1 Discovery earlier this month, headed by John Patzakis, former President of eDiscovery at X1.

UberMedia: Chime.in Hits 5M Uniques

socalTECH

Pasadena-based Chime.in , the online social networking site and mobile app run by UberMedia , has now seen more than 5M uniques since its launch, UberMedia said today.
